This blend combines two synthetic peptides, CJC-1295 and Ipamorelin, that are being researched for their potential to stimulate the release of growth hormone (GH). While both are classified as growth hormone secretagogues, they appear to have distinct mechanisms of action. CJC-1295 mimics Growth Hormone-Releasing Hormone (GHRH) and acts on GHRH receptors, while Ipamorelin mimics ghrelin and acts on the GHS-R1a receptor.

Key Research Areas 🧪

1. Half-Life and Pharmacokinetics

The peptides have different half-lives, which may lead to synergistic action. Research suggests Ipamorelin has a short half-life of about 2 hours, with its potential action declining rapidly. In contrast, CJC-1295 appears to have a much longer half-life, ranging from 5.8 to 8.1 days, due to its modifications with a drug affinity complex (DAC) that allows it to bind to plasma proteins. This difference in half-life is thought to create a sustained release of GH, with Ipamorelin providing an initial pulse and CJC-1295 providing a prolonged effect.

2. GH Release and Somatotrophs

Both peptides are posited to trigger the anterior pituitary gland to secrete GH. CJC-1295's action is thought to activate intracellular signaling pathways that lead to the transcription of GH-related genes. Ipamorelin's action on the GHS-R1a receptor is believed to activate a different signaling cascade involving phospholipase C (PLC) and the release of calcium ions. Studies on CJC-1295 have also suggested that it may interact with the somatotroph cells, which produce GH, potentially increasing their proliferation.

3. Nitrogen Balance

The combined action of the peptides on GH production is suggested to lead to a positive nitrogen balance and a potential increase in lean mass. A study on Ipamorelin indicated that it might lead to a 20% decline in urea-N production, a potential marker of nitrogen processing. This suggests that the peptide may help reinstate nitrogen equilibrium, which is crucial for protein synthesis and tissue growth.
